These are the top ten health-related impediments to U-M students' academic success, according to the 2018 U-M National College Health Assessment:
- Stress - 29%
- Anxiety - 22%
- Sleep Difficulties - 19%
- Depression - 15%
- Cold, Flu, Sore Throat - 14%
- Internet Use/Computer Games - 12%
- Participation in Extracurricular Activities - 11%
- Work - 10%
- Concern for a Troubled Friend or Family Member - 9%
- Relationship Difficulties - 8%
